No experience Telecom Network Engineer resume guidance
Starting a career as a Telecom Network Engineer without formal experience can be challenging but not impossible. Focus on building a strong foundation in key areas such as Network Design and Protocol Analysis. Online courses and certifications can provide you with the necessary technical knowledge and skills in VoIP Technologies and Wireless Communication. Volunteering for projects or internships can offer practical experience and exposure to real-world network scenarios. Networking with professionals in the field can also provide valuable insights and mentorship opportunities. Additionally, developing soft skills like Project Management and Customer Support will enhance your employability. Tailor your resume to highlight relevant coursework, projects, and any hands-on experience you have gained. Emphasize your enthusiasm for learning and your commitment to staying updated with the latest industry trends and technologies.

Frequently asked questions
What are the key responsibilities of a Telecom Network Engineer?
A Telecom Network Engineer is responsible for designing, implementing, and maintaining telecommunications networks, ensuring network reliability and security.
What skills are essential for a Telecom Network Engineer?
Essential skills include Network Design, Troubleshooting, VoIP Technologies, Wireless Communication, and Protocol Analysis.

How do I gain experience if I am new to telecom engineering?
Consider online courses, certifications, internships, and networking with industry professionals.
What role does Project Management play in telecom engineering?
Project Management ensures that network projects are delivered on time, within budget, and meet quality standards.
Why is Protocol Analysis important?
Protocol Analysis helps identify and resolve network bottlenecks, improving efficiency and performance.
What is the significance of VoIP Technologies in telecom?
VoIP Technologies enhance communication capabilities, allowing for efficient and cost-effective voice communication over the internet.

What is the role of Fiber Optics in telecommunications?
Fiber Optics technology is used to transmit data at high speeds over long distances, reducing latency and improving network performance.
